4895
4895 is a odd composite number that follows 4894 and precedes 4896. It is composed of 8 distinct factors: 1, 5, 11, 55, 89, 445, 979, 4895. Its prime factorization can be written as 5 × 11 × 89. 4895 is classified as a deficient number based on the sum of its proper divisors. In computer science, 4895 is represented as 1001100011111 in binary and 131F in hexadecimal.
